The Financial Times is seeking a Reporter for Ignites Asia, responsible for covering the asset management industry in Asia. The role involves researching and writing original articles, generating story ideas, building a network of sources, and moderating webcasts and video interviews.

Role involves:

  • Covering the asset management industry in Asia.
  • Researching and writing three to four original articles per week.
  • Generating original story ideas.
  • Building and cultivating an extensive network of sources.
  • Moderating webcasts and video interviews.

Requirements:

  • Proven experience covering the asset management industry and/or financial markets in Asia.
  • Strong contacts within the industry.
  • Ability to meet deadlines and work under pressure.
  • Willingness to travel within Asia.
  • Excellent command of oral and written English.

The Financial Times is a globally recognized and respected news organization specializing in business and economic news. It delivers in-depth analysis, commentary, and data to a sophisticated, international audience of business leaders, investors, and policymakers. With a focus on accuracy and integrity, the FT provides comprehensive coverage of corporate finance, markets, industries, and global economies. It leverages digital platforms and traditional print media to deliver its content, establishing itself as a key source of information and insight for the global business community.
